About Holcim
Holcim is the leading partner for sustainable construction, creating value across the built environment from infrastructure and industry to buildings. Headquartered in Zug, Switzerland, Holcim has more than 48,000 employees in 45 attractive markets - across Europe, Asia Pacific, Latin America, Middle East & Africa. Holcim offers high-valued end-to-end Building Materials and Building Solutions, powered by premium brands including, ECOPact® low-carbon concrete and ECOPlanet® low-carbon cement.

The Opportunity
As an Agitator Driver, you will play a crucial role in the delivery of concrete to our customers. Operating our specialised vehicles called agitators, you will ensure the timely and safe transportation of concrete from our plants to construction sites. This role requires a keen attention to safety, a strong sense of responsibility, and a dedication to delivering exceptional service.
Key responsibilities include:
- Safely operate agitator trucks to deliver concrete to various locations.
- Follow prescribed delivery schedules to ensure timely deliveries to construction sites.
- Inspect vehicles before and after each trip, reporting any maintenance or safety issues.
- Comply with all traffic regulations and maintain a clean driving record.
- Adhere to health and safety guidelines, both on the road and at job sites.
- Provide excellent customer service, building positive relationships with clients.
- Maintain accurate records of deliveries and paperwork.
